Costs of Nursing Home in Kentwood

The cost of nursing home care in Kentwood, MI, varies depending on the level of care required and the facility chosen. On average, residents can expect to pay between $7,000 and $8,500 per month for a private room in a nursing home. Costs may be lower for semi-private rooms or vary based on specific services and amenities offered by the facility.

Visiting Nurse Association

1401 Cedar St NE, Michigan 49503
Visiting Nurse Association at 1401 Cedar St NE is part of Corewell Health, and it's known locally for providing skilled nursing and rehab services to older adults who need more support than they can get at home. The staff includes registered nurses, occupational therapists, and aides who help with everything from wound care and medication management to physical therapy and daily routines.
